Forget the everyday and free your heart for a blissful moment. Yufuin Onsen Yama no Hotel Musouen opened in 1938 as the Ryokan "Hinodeya," utilizing the renowned hot spring source, Omusou Onsen. In 1966, with the construction of a new main building, it began operations as the current Yama no Hotel Musouen. Among the uniquely charming Ryokans of Yufuin Onsen, Musouen is located on an elevated area on the southern side of the Yufuin Basin, offering a panoramic view of the majestic Mount Yufu and the Yufuin Basin. With a focus on large-scale open-air baths and breathtaking views, we take pride in our Ryokan. A Western-style villa overlooking the ocean, located on a hill in Izu Kogen. The property offers 11 rooms in 7 types, ranging from rooms with private open-air baths to family standard types. Meals are based on European-style course cuisine, with various upgraded Plans available. The Onsen features three spectacular open-air baths, including private reservable ones. The 4,000-tsubo premises include tennis and futsal courts, allowing you to refresh amidst nature. Enjoy a panoramic ocean view of Sagami Bay, stretching to the Miura Peninsula and Boso Peninsula. A quiet standalone Property located at the foot of Mt. Chausu, on the border of Aichi and Nagano prefectures. Featuring dishes that abundantly use the flavors of Southern Shinshu, such as horse sashimi, Shinshu beef, and Gohei mochi, along with specialty robatayaki. The Chausuyama natural Onsen offers 24-hour bathing with indoor baths and garden open-air baths. The 10-tatami mat Japanese-style rooms provide both spaciousness and scenic views. The open-air bath for women is nestled within a well-maintained garden, allowing guests to enjoy the scenery while taking breaks during long soaks. Additionally, seasonal kaiseki courses featuring matsutake mushrooms or crab shabu-shabu are also available.
